B
Youorderthefoodonthemobilephone,butitasksforyourphonenumber.Yourideinataxi,andyourideina
addresseswillbeknown.Informationcollectioniseverywhere.
However,thepersonalinformationcollectedbycompaniescanbeleaked(泄露)formarketing.Accordingtoa
surveyof5,458people,85.2%ofpeoplesaidtheyhadexperiencedpersonalinformationleaksontheirsmartphones.
Mostsaidtheygotunwantedcallsortextmessagesafter-wards.
Todealwithsuchproblems,onNo.LthePersonalInformationProtectionLawcameoutinChina.Itisthefirst
lawonpersonalinformationprotection.
Thelawsayspersonalinformationisanykindofinformationaboutpeoplewhohavebeenorcanberecognized.
Soaperson'sname,dateofbirth,IDnumber,addressandphonenumberareallpersonalinformation.
Therearealsosomekindsofpersonalinformationthatareregardedas“sensitive”(敏感的):fingerprints,faces,
medicalhealthandfinancialaccounts(金融賬戶).
Accordingtothelaw,collecting,using,storingandtradingpersonalinformationwillbestrictlymanaged.Onekey
ruleisthatthosehandlingpersonalinformationshouldletusersknowandgettheiragreement.Therulesareevenstricter
forsensitiveinformation.

Whatwillastronauts(宇航員)eatwhenaspacetriptakesyears?
“Lotsoffreshvegetables,saysDr.JanetWilliams,whoseteamhavespentthelast10yearslearninghowtogrow
plantsinaspacestation,Andit'sagoodthingthatshehasalreadystartedherwork,becausespacegardeningcanbe
reallyhard.
Asusual,astronautGeorgeWhitelookedintotheclosedplantroom.HehadplantedDr.Williams'quick-growing
seedlingsinit,butnoneofthestemswereshowing.Heopenedtheroomtocheckandfoundtheproblem.Thestems
weren'tgrowingupwardandtherootsweren'tgrowingdownward.OnEarth,gravity(重力)helpsaplantsstemsand
rootstofind“up"and"down”.However,inthespacestation,therewasalmostnogravity.
Dr.Williamssuggestedasolution:givetheplantsmoregliht,asplantsalsousesunlighttofindtheirway.Andit
worked.Whentheplantshadmorelight,thestemsturnedupandtherootswentdown.
NowDr.Williamswasfreetoworryaboutthenextproblem:Wouldherbabyplantslivetoflower?Canwegrow
foodonaspacejourney?
Manyplantsdiedinthespacestation.Dr.Williamsthoughtsheknewwhy:thespaceplantswerehungryforair.
PlantslivebytakingupCO2fromtheair.Sinceaplantusesitupintheairaround,theplantneedsmovingairtobring
moreCO2closetoitssurface!OnEarth,theairisalwaysmoving.Gravitypullsdowncoldair,andwarmairrises.And
withtheseairmovements,plantsgetenoughCO2.
Manyearlierexperimentswithplantsinspacehadusedclosed,rooms.Dr.Williamstriedanewgreenhousethat
hadafantokeeptheairmove.Theplantslovedit.Theyfloweredandevenproducedmoreseeds.UsingDr.Williams'
method,astronautGeorgecompletedthefirstseed-to-seedexperimentinspace,andmovedoneplantclosertoagarden
inspace.
“Andthis,^^saysDr.Williams,C4isgoodnewsforlong—termspacetraveL^^
